Abstract:
Transparent hydrogels comprising isotactic polymethylmethacrylate and syndiotactic polymethylmethacylate make semi-permeable membranes of good strength and permeability which have particular utility in hemodialysis.
Abstract:
PURPOSE:To clearly print the halftone dots and whitened letters of a photosensitive resin plate by using an antihalation material consisting of a substance generating benzoyl radicals under light or heat and phenolic resin or chloroprene resin. CONSTITUTION:Benzoyl methyl ether or the like generating benzoyl radicals under light or heat and phenolic resin including that for a commercially available adhesive or commercially available chloroprene resin are dissolved in a solvent such as toluene or acetone and applied to a support, or said radical generating substance and resin are mixed with an adhesive to form an adhesive layer on a support. A photosensitive layer is then formed to manufacture a material for a photosensitive resin plate. In a plate making process the radical generating substance is decomposed with active light beams, or it is decomposed by heating when the material is manufactured. By the decomposition a benzophenone structure absorbing active light beams is formed through reaction with the resin, and an effective antihalation action is obtd.
Abstract:
PURPOSE:A primer composition usable for porous construction materials, capable of improving adhesiveness and durability of silicone sealants, without peeling of the sealants from wet members, comprising (A) a copolymer of methacrylate and silane and (B) an isocyanate group-containing compound.
Abstract:
PURPOSE:A dispersion for primer which consists of a specific copolymer and a high- molecular compound having a low water absorbability and which is used in bonding a cold-setting silicone sealant with a base material in particular. CONSTITUTION:A dispersion which contains a copolymer (A), obtained from the polymerization of a mixture of a hydroxyl group-containing radical-polymerizable monomer, a carboxyl group-containing radical-polymerizable monomer, and another radical-copolymerizable monomer, and a high-molecular compound (B), having incompatibility with (A), water insolubility, and a water absorbability of 10% or less, e.g., polyamide, polyester, PVC, etc. The preferred mixing ratio of the copolymer (A) and the high-molecular compound (B) for a general purpose primer is 95-40wt% for (A) and 5-60wt% for (B). The dispersion can be used in many kinds of base materials.
